Originally Posted by Eric Perry
It's actually at an Audi dealer.
I have a 2011 and I bought mines and a Ford Dealer. Sunroof rattle Quick Fix. Drive the car again and try get it above 40 mph and listen out for a winding sound. If its a auto start it up when it's cold and see if you hear a gargling sound. Those are the two main issues the car is known for. Propeller drive shaft (winding sound) and And that cold start sound. If you don't hear either then you have yourself a deal. This Car is special so is you get it enjoy.
